Excel Percentage Calculator
Calculate what percentage a number is of a total in Excel – with step-by-step results and visualization
Complete Guide: How to Calculate Percentage of a Total in Excel
Calculating percentages in Excel is one of the most fundamental yet powerful skills for data analysis. Whether you’re working with financial data, survey results, or sales figures, understanding how to find what percentage a number represents of a total is essential for making data-driven decisions.
Basic Percentage Formula in Excel
The core formula for calculating what percentage a number (part) is of a total is:
= (Part / Total) * 100
This formula works because:
- Dividing the part by the total gives you the decimal representation
- Multiplying by 100 converts the decimal to a percentage
Step-by-Step: Calculating Percentage of Total
Let’s walk through a practical example. Suppose you have quarterly sales data and want to find what percentage each quarter contributes to the annual total.
| Quarter | Sales ($) | Percentage of Total |
|---|---|---|
| Q1 | 125,000 | =B2/$B$6 |
| Q2 | 150,000 | =B3/$B$6 |
| Q3 | 175,000 | =B4/$B$6 |
| Q4 | 200,000 | =B5/$B$6 |
| Total | 650,000 | 100% |
To calculate the percentage for Q1:
- Click in cell C2 (where you want the percentage to appear)
- Type the formula:
=B2/$B$6 - Press Enter to calculate the decimal value (0.1923 in this case)
- Select the cell again and click the Percentage button (%) on the Home tab to format as a percentage
- Drag the fill handle down to copy the formula to other cells
Using Absolute References ($)
The dollar signs in $B$6 create an absolute reference, which is crucial when copying the formula. Without them, Excel would change the reference to B7, B8, etc. when you drag the formula down, causing incorrect calculations.
Alternative Methods for Percentage Calculations
Method 1: Using the Percentage Format Button
After entering your division formula (part/total), you can:
- Select the cells with your results
- Go to the Home tab
- Click the Percentage Style button (%) in the Number group
- Excel will automatically multiply by 100 and add the % symbol
Method 2: Using the PERCENTAGE Function (Excel 365)
Newer versions of Excel include a PERCENTAGE function:
=PERCENTAGE(part, total)
This function automatically handles the division and formatting for you.
Common Percentage Calculation Scenarios
Scenario 1: Calculating Grade Percentages
For a student with test scores of 88, 92, and 79 out of 100 each:
= (88+92+79)/300 * 100
Would return 86.33% as the overall grade percentage.
Scenario 2: Calculating Sales Commissions
If a salesperson earns 5% commission on $45,000 in sales:
= 45000 * 5%
Or alternatively:
= 45000 * 0.05
Scenario 3: Calculating Percentage Increase/Decrease
To find the percentage change between an old value (150) and new value (180):
= (180-150)/150 * 100
This would show a 20% increase.
Advanced Percentage Techniques
Conditional Percentage Calculations
You can combine percentage calculations with logical functions. For example, to calculate a 10% bonus only for sales over $10,000:
=IF(B2>10000, B2*10%, 0)
Percentage of Multiple Criteria
To find what percentage of total sales came from a specific region and product:
=SUMIFS(Sales, Region, "North", Product, "Widget") / SUM(Sales)
Dynamic Percentage Calculations with Tables
When working with Excel Tables (Ctrl+T), your percentage formulas will automatically expand to include new rows of data, making your calculations dynamic and future-proof.
Troubleshooting Common Percentage Errors
| Error | Cause | Solution |
|---|---|---|
| ###### | Column isn’t wide enough to display the percentage | Double-click the right edge of the column header to autofit |
| #DIV/0! | Dividing by zero (total cell is empty or zero) | Use IFERROR: =IFERROR(part/total, 0) |
| Incorrect percentage | Forgetting to use absolute references | Add $ signs: =B2/$B$10 |
| Percentage shows as decimal | Cell not formatted as percentage | Select cell → Home tab → Percentage button |
Percentage Calculations in Excel vs. Google Sheets
While the core percentage calculations work identically in both Excel and Google Sheets, there are some differences in implementation:
| Feature | Excel | Google Sheets |
|---|---|---|
| Percentage format button | Home tab → Number group | Format → Number → Percent |
| Auto-fill handle | Small square in bottom-right corner | Small blue square in bottom-right |
| Absolute references | Press F4 to toggle | Manual entry or menu option |
| PERCENTAGE function | Available in Excel 365 | Not available (use basic formula) |
| Real-time collaboration | Limited (SharePoint required) | Native real-time collaboration |
Best Practices for Working with Percentages in Excel
- Always use absolute references for the total cell in your percentage formulas to prevent errors when copying
- Format cells before entering data when possible to avoid manual formatting later
- Use helper columns for complex percentage calculations to make your formulas easier to audit
- Document your calculations with comments (right-click → Insert Comment) for future reference
- Validate your totals by ensuring they sum to 100% when appropriate
- Consider using named ranges for important total cells to make formulas more readable
- Test edge cases like zero values to ensure your formulas handle them gracefully
Frequently Asked Questions About Excel Percentages
How do I calculate what percentage 50 is of 200?
Use the formula =50/200 and format as a percentage. The result will be 25%.
Why does my percentage show as 1.00 when it should be 100%?
This happens when you’ve already multiplied by 100 in your formula but also applied percentage formatting (which multiplies by 100 again). Either remove the *100 from your formula or remove the percentage formatting.
Can I calculate percentages across multiple sheets?
Yes, use 3D references like =Sheet2!B2/Sheet1!$B$10 to reference cells on different sheets.
How do I find the original number when I only have the percentage?
If 25% represents 50, use =50/25% or =50/0.25 to find the original total (200 in this case).
Why does Excel sometimes show percentages with many decimal places?
This occurs when the underlying decimal calculation results in a repeating decimal. Use the DECREASE DECIMAL button or the ROUND function to limit decimal places.
Real-World Applications of Percentage Calculations
Financial Analysis
Investors use percentage calculations to determine:
- Return on Investment (ROI) = (Current Value – Original Value)/Original Value * 100
- Profit margins = (Revenue – Costs)/Revenue * 100
- Expense ratios = (Specific Expense/Total Expenses) * 100
Market Research
Analysts calculate:
- Market share = (Company Sales/Industry Sales) * 100
- Survey response percentages = (Responses for Option/Total Responses) * 100
- Customer satisfaction scores = (Satisfied Customers/Total Customers) * 100
Project Management
Project managers track:
- Completion percentage = (Completed Tasks/Total Tasks) * 100
- Budget utilization = (Spent Budget/Total Budget) * 100
- Resource allocation = (Hours Spent/Total Available Hours) * 100
Education
Educators calculate:
- Grade percentages = (Earned Points/Total Points) * 100
- Attendance rates = (Days Present/Total Days) * 100
- Test score distributions = (Students in Range/Total Students) * 100
Automating Percentage Calculations with Excel Tables
Excel Tables (created with Ctrl+T) offer several advantages for percentage calculations:
- Automatic expansion: Formulas automatically fill down when new rows are added
- Structured references: Use column names instead of cell references (e.g.,
=[@Sales]/Total) - Total row: Automatically calculates sums and other aggregates
- Consistent formatting: Alternating row colors improve readability
To create a percentage column in an Excel Table:
- Select your data range and press Ctrl+T to create a table
- Add a new column for your percentage calculation
- In the first cell of your new column, type your formula using structured references
- Press Enter – the formula will automatically fill down for all rows
- Format the column as a percentage
Visualizing Percentages with Excel Charts
Excel offers several chart types that effectively display percentage data:
Pie Charts
Best for showing how parts relate to a whole (but limited to 5-7 categories for clarity). To create:
- Select your data (including labels and values)
- Go to Insert → Pie Chart
- Choose 2-D Pie for best readability
- Add data labels showing percentages
Stacked Column Charts
Excellent for comparing percentages across categories. To create:
- Organize data with categories in rows and components in columns
- Select your data range
- Go to Insert → Stacked Column Chart
- Format to show percentages on each segment
100% Stacked Column Charts
Shows each category as 100%, with components as percentages of the whole:
- Select your data
- Go to Insert → 100% Stacked Column
- This automatically converts values to percentages
Gauge Charts (Using Doughnut Charts)
For KPI dashboards showing progress toward goals:
- Create a doughnut chart with your actual value and target value
- Format the target series to be invisible (no fill)
- Add a data label showing the percentage
Percentage Calculations in Excel PivotTables
PivotTables offer powerful percentage calculation options:
- Create your PivotTable (Insert → PivotTable)
- Add your data fields to the Rows and Values areas
- Right-click a value cell → Show Values As → % of Grand Total
- Other options include % of Column Total, % of Row Total, and % Of
For example, to see what percentage each product contributes to total sales:
- Add Product to Rows area
- Add Sales to Values area
- Right-click any sales value → Show Values As → % of Grand Total
Excel Functions for Advanced Percentage Calculations
PERCENTILE and PERCENTRANK Functions
=PERCENTILE(array, k) returns the k-th percentile value in a range (where k is between 0 and 1).
=PERCENTRANK(array, x, [significance]) returns the rank of a value as a percentage of the data set.
QUOTIENT and MOD Functions
For more complex percentage distributions:
=QUOTIENT(numerator, denominator) returns the integer portion of a division
=MOD(numerator, denominator) returns the remainder
ROUND Function for Percentage Precision
=ROUND(number, num_digits) helps control decimal places in percentages:
=ROUND(47/234, 3) → Returns 0.201 (20.1% when formatted)
Excel Shortcuts for Percentage Calculations
| Task | Windows Shortcut | Mac Shortcut |
|---|---|---|
| Apply percentage format | Ctrl+Shift+% | Cmd+Shift+% |
| Toggle absolute/relative references | F4 | Cmd+T |
| Autosum selected cells | Alt+= | Cmd+Shift+T |
| Fill down formula | Ctrl+D | Cmd+D |
| Copy formula from above cell | Ctrl+’ | Cmd+’ |
| Increase decimal places | Alt+H, 0 | Cmd+[ |
| Decrease decimal places | Alt+H, 9 | Cmd+] |
Common Mistakes to Avoid with Excel Percentages
- Double multiplication: Multiplying by 100 in your formula AND applying percentage formatting (results in values 100x too large)
- Incorrect absolute references: Forgetting $ signs when copying percentage formulas
- Dividing by zero: Not handling cases where the total might be zero
- Mismatched ranges: Selecting different-sized ranges for numerator and denominator
- Formatting before calculation: Applying percentage format to empty cells can cause confusion
- Ignoring significant figures: Reporting percentages with inappropriate precision (e.g., 12.345678% when 12.3% would suffice)
- Mixing formatted and unformatted values: Combining pre-formatted percentages with decimal values in calculations
Excel Percentage Calculations in Different Industries
Retail
Retail analysts calculate:
- Gross margin percentage = (Revenue – COGS)/Revenue * 100
- Markup percentage = (Selling Price – Cost)/Cost * 100
- Inventory turnover ratio = Cost of Goods Sold/Average Inventory
- Sell-through rate = (Units Sold/Units Received) * 100
Manufacturing
Production managers track:
- Defect rate = (Defective Units/Total Units) * 100
- Capacity utilization = (Actual Output/Potential Output) * 100
- On-time delivery = (On-time Shipments/Total Shipments) * 100
- Scrap percentage = (Scrap Material/Total Material) * 100
Healthcare
Medical professionals analyze:
- Patient recovery rate = (Recovered Patients/Total Patients) * 100
- Readmission rate = (Readmitted Patients/Discharged Patients) * 100
- Treatment effectiveness = (Improved Patients/Total Patients) * 100
- Occupancy rate = (Occupied Beds/Total Beds) * 100
Marketing
Marketers measure:
- Conversion rate = (Conversions/Visitors) * 100
- Click-through rate = (Clicks/Impressions) * 100
- Bounce rate = (Single-page Visits/Total Visits) * 100
- Return on ad spend = (Revenue from Ads/Cost of Ads) * 100
Future Trends in Excel Percentage Calculations
As Excel continues to evolve, we’re seeing several trends in percentage calculations:
Dynamic Arrays
New dynamic array functions like FILTER, SORT, and UNIQUE allow for more sophisticated percentage calculations that automatically spill into multiple cells.
AI-Powered Insights
Excel’s Ideas feature can automatically detect percentage relationships in your data and suggest visualizations.
Natural Language Queries
With Excel’s natural language processing, you can type questions like “what percentage of total sales came from the North region?” and get immediate answers.
Enhanced Data Types
New data types like Stocks and Geography include built-in percentage metrics that update automatically.
Power Query Integration
More users are performing percentage calculations during the data import/transformation stage using Power Query.
Learning Resources for Excel Percentage Mastery
To deepen your Excel percentage calculation skills, consider these resources:
Free Online Courses
- Microsoft Excel Essential Training (LinkedIn Learning)
- Excel Skills for Business (Coursera – Macquarie University)
- Excel for Data Analysis (edX – IBM)
Books
- “Excel 2023 Bible” by Michael Alexander
- “Excel Data Analysis For Dummies” by Stephen L. Nelson
- “Advanced Excel Essentials” by Jordan Goldmeier
YouTube Channels
- ExcelIsFun (Mike Girvin)
- Leila Gharani
- MyOnlineTrainingHub
Practice Databases
- Kaggle (real-world datasets for practice)
- Google Dataset Search
- U.S. Government Open Data
Conclusion: Mastering Excel Percentage Calculations
Mastering percentage calculations in Excel opens up powerful analytical capabilities across virtually every industry and discipline. From basic business metrics to complex statistical analysis, percentages help transform raw numbers into meaningful insights.
Remember these key principles:
- The core formula is always part/total * 100
- Absolute references ($) are crucial when copying percentage formulas
- Excel’s percentage formatting handles the *100 conversion automatically
- Visualizations like pie charts and stacked columns make percentages more intuitive
- PivotTables offer built-in percentage calculation options
- Always validate your calculations with simple test cases
As you become more comfortable with basic percentage calculations, explore Excel’s advanced functions and features to handle more complex scenarios. The ability to accurately calculate and interpret percentages will significantly enhance your data analysis skills and decision-making capabilities.